Sudoku: 9*9 grid with 3*3 regions

game - Sudoku

Sudoku game.

Sudoku is a logic-based,combinatorial number-placement puzzle. The objective is to fill a 9*9 grid with digits so that each column, each row, and each of the nine 3*3 sub-grids that compose the grid (also called "boxes", "blocks", "regions", or "sub-squares") contains all of the digits from 1 to 9. The puzzle setter provides a partially completed grid, which typically has a unique solution. Completed puzzles are always a type of Latin square with an additional constraint on the contents of individual regions. For example, the same single integer may not appear twice in the same 9*9 playing board row or column or in any of the nine 3*3 subregions of the 9*9 playing board.
